City Manager John Szerlag Promotes Division Chief Ryan Lamb to Fire Chief

 

Cape Coral City Manager John Szerlag has promoted Fire Division Chief Ryan Lamb to the position of Fire Chief.  His appointment is effective Saturday, May 19.   

 

“Ryan has proven to be a professional leader and has been an integral part of the Fire Department's command staff for a number of years,” said Szerlag. “His management style and communication skills will be assets as the Department moves forward.”

 

 

Chief Lamb began his career as a volunteer Firefighter in Punta Gorda, FL.  He was hired by the Cape Coral Fire Department in 2005 and was promoted to Fire Division Chief of Professional Standards in 2014.  Professional Standards is responsible for the development of policies, hiring, training, EMS and Special Operations programs within the Department.  He also has served in the positions of Firefighter, Engineer/Driver, Paramedic Field Training Officer, Acting Lieutenant and Battalion Chief.

 

In 2017, Chief Lamb received the Chief Fire Officer (CFO) designation by the Center for Public Safety Excellence.  The CFO program recognizes individuals who demonstrate excellence in seven measured components including experience, education, professional development, professional contributions, association membership, community involvement and technical competence. There are 1,305 CFOs worldwide.

Chief Lamb holds a Master’s in Administration from Barry University and a Bachelor’s in Public Safety Administration from St. Petersburg College.  He currently is enrolled in the National Fire Academy Executive Fire Officer Program.

 

 

Chief Lamb’s starting salary will be $133,000.
